Cambodia Plant Genomics Market Challenges

In the Cambodia Plant Genomics Market, challenges include limited funding for research and development, lack of skilled personnel in molecular biology and genomics, and inadequate infrastructure for conducting advanced genetic studies. Additionally, the country`s regulatory framework for biotechnology and genetically modified organisms (GMOs) is still evolving, leading to uncertainties and barriers in bringing genetically engineered crops to market. Limited access to cutting-edge technologies and equipment further hinders the progress of plant genomics research in Cambodia. Overcoming these challenges will require increased investment in research capabilities, capacity building programs to train local scientists, and collaboration with international partners to access resources and expertise in plant genomics.

Cambodia Plant Genomics Market Government Polices

The Cambodian government has been actively promoting the development of the plant genomics market through various policies and initiatives. One key policy is the National Strategic Development Plan, which emphasizes the importance of agricultural research and innovation in enhancing food security and promoting sustainable agriculture. Additionally, the government has established the Ministry of Agriculture, Forestry, and Fisheries to oversee and support the growth of the agricultural sector, including plant genomics research. Furthermore, Cambodia has been working to strengthen intellectual property rights protection to encourage investment in plant genomics research and development. Overall, the government`s policies are focused on driving innovation, improving crop productivity, and ensuring the long-term sustainability of the plant genomics market in Cambodia.
